Sec. 35. Recovery against indemnification. A motor vehicle insurer that defends or indemnifies a claim against a shared vehicle that is excluded under the terms of its policy shall have the right to seek recovery against the motor vehicle insurer of the car-sharing program if the claim is:
(1)made against the shared-vehicle owner or the shared-vehicle driver for loss or
injury that occurs during the car-sharing period; and
(2)excluded under the terms of its policy.
